No traffic touring cycling routes around Homburg traverse diverse landscapes, including broad meadowlands, lush green forests, and rolling hills. The region is characterized by its well-established cycling infrastructure, with many routes following former railway lines, ensuring predominantly flat and accessible rides. Natural features such as the Blies meadows, Kirkeler Bachtal, and the Bliesgau Biosphere Reserve offer scenic backdrops for cycling. This area provides a variety of no traffic cycling experiences, from relaxed rides through nature reserves to longer routes connecting…

May 27, 2026, Former Glantal Railway Track

A scenically beautiful cycle path (Glan-Blies-Weg, approx. 130 km) from Forbach in Lorraine to Staudernheim. Hardly any inclines, almost entirely paved, only finely gravelled between Homburg-Bruchhof and Glan-Münchweiler.

Frequently Asked Questions

How many no-traffic touring cycling routes are available around Homburg?

There are over 60 dedicated no-traffic touring cycling routes around Homburg, offering a wide range of experiences. These include 26 easy routes perfect for a relaxed ride, 24 moderate options for those seeking a bit more challenge, and 14 difficult routes for experienced cyclists looking for a demanding tour.

Are there any easy, family-friendly no-traffic routes suitable for beginners?

Yes, Homburg offers several easy, no-traffic routes ideal for families and beginners. A great option is the Beeder Bruch Nature Reserve loop from Homburg, which is just over 18 km long and features minimal elevation gain. Another excellent choice is the Old Water House Käshofen – Lambsbach Valley loop from Kirrberg, offering a pleasant 14.7 km ride through scenic landscapes.

What kind of landscapes can I expect on these no-traffic touring routes?

The no-traffic touring routes around Homburg traverse diverse and picturesque landscapes. You'll encounter broad meadow landscapes, lush green forests, and idyllic settings like the Blies meadows and the Kirkeler Bachtal. Many routes, such as those in the Bliesgau Biosphere Reserve, offer opportunities to observe wildlife like wild white storks, Konik horses, and Heck cattle, providing a unique natural experience.

Are there any circular no-traffic touring routes in the Homburg area?

Yes, many of the no-traffic touring routes around Homburg are designed as circular loops, allowing you to start and end at the same point. Examples include the Southern Bliesgau – Langental Valley loop from Einöd (Saar) and the Stork Meadow on the River Blies – Langental Valley loop from Homburg (Saar) Hauptbahnhof, both offering extensive circular tours through beautiful scenery.

What are some notable attractions or points of interest along the no-traffic cycling routes?

Along the no-traffic cycling routes, you can discover several interesting attractions. The Beeder Bruch Nature Reserve is a significant natural highlight. You might also encounter the Würzbacher Pond, a tranquil spot, or the unique Sonnendach Rock Formation. For history enthusiasts, the Wörschweiler Abbey Ruins are accessible via a more challenging route.

Is the Glan-Blies Cycle Path a good option for no-traffic touring cycling?

Absolutely. The Glan-Blies Cycle Path is highly recommended for no-traffic touring cycling. It largely follows former railway lines, ensuring a predominantly flat and accessible ride, making it ideal for a relaxed tour. This path extends approximately 130 km and winds through the scenic Bliesgau Biosphere Reserve, offering a fantastic car-free experience.

Can I reach the starting points of these routes using public transport with my bike?

Homburg (Saar) Hauptbahnhof serves as a convenient starting point for several routes, such as the Stork Meadow on the River Blies – Langental Valley loop. Public transport options, including regional trains, often allow bicycle carriage, though it's always advisable to check specific train or bus operator policies and peak hour restrictions beforehand.
